Is it safe to attempt electrical repairs myself?
No — electrical work in Australia is legally restricted to licensed electricians, and for good reason. Faults that look minor can hide live wiring, damaged insulation or overloaded circuits. Warning signs such as frequent breaker tripping, buzzing outlets, scorch marks or mild shocks all need a professional assessment. Call a licensed electrician rather than risking a serious shock or fire — we can usually diagnose the cause quickly and safely.
